Hair that hasn’t been dyed before is commonly referred to as virgin hair and this will be lightened easily and reliably by a permanent dye with a high volume of developer. If you’re naturally dark, you won’t get your hair up to a true icy or platinum blonde the first time you bleach.

With that being said, dark hair has loads of eumelanin, making it naturally more difficult to lighten. It naturally gravitates toward the darker end of the color scale. If you want to bleach your hair, you should not lift more than four levels of color on the chart in one session.

An experienced colourist will not ignore contra-indications. Bleaching the hair increases porosity and can degrade elasticity. If bleach is over processed it can easily destroy the cuticle and cortex cells that are responsible for supporting the strength of the hair. Bleach dissolves the black/brown and then the red/yellow pigments during oxidisation. If you need more advice on how to bleach your hair at home, you can always speak to a hair professional.
